About 2 years ago, I started making these magnets, but never finished the project. Since I am on a UFO jag, I decided to finished these turtles. And, I am so glad I did. They are the cutes thing, swimming on my fridge. I used a turtle drawing from here as a pattern. The beading is freestyle. I just sewed what I liked. I use acrylic felt for the “stuffing” and stitched around the edges to hide the felt. A magnet is inserted in the middle.
